1989 Ford Escort vs. 1963 Sunbeam Alpine

To start off, 1989 Ford Escort is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1963 Sunbeam Alpine.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1963 Sunbeam Alpine would be higher. At 1,859 cc (4 cylinders), 1989 Ford Escort is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1989 Ford Escort (89 HP @ 4600 RPM) has 8 more horse power than 1963 Sunbeam Alpine. (81 HP @ 5200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1989 Ford Escort should accelerate faster than 1963 Sunbeam Alpine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1963 Sunbeam Alpine weights approximately 5 kg more than 1989 Ford Escort.

Let's talk about torque, 1989 Ford Escort (144 Nm @ 3400 RPM) has 18 more torque (in Nm) than 1963 Sunbeam Alpine. (126 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 1989 Ford Escort will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1963 Sunbeam Alpine.

Compare all specifications:

1989 Ford Escort 1963 Sunbeam Alpine
Make Ford Sunbeam
Model Escort Alpine
Year Released 1989 1963
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1859 cc 1592 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 89 HP 81 HP
Engine RPM 4600 RPM 5200 RPM
Torque 144 Nm 126 Nm
Torque RPM 3400 RPM 3600 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Number of Seats 5 seats 2 seats
Vehicle Weight 1025 kg 1030 kg
Vehicle Length 4300 mm 3950 mm
Vehicle Width 1680 mm 1540 mm
Vehicle Height 1370 mm 1310 mm
Wheelbase Size 2400 mm 2190 mm
